有三根針A、B、C。A針上有N個盤子,大的在下,小的在上,要求把這N個盤子從A針移到C針,在移動過程中可以借助B針,每次只允許移動一個盤, ...
用什么語言解法都差不多,思路都是一樣,遞歸,這其中只要注重於開始和結果的狀態就可以了,對於中間過程,並不需要深究。 我細細思考了一下,還是算了。 代碼其實很簡單注重的是思路。 問題描述:有一個梵塔,塔內有三個座A B C,A座上有諾干個盤子,盤子大小不等,大的在下,小的在上。把這些個盤子從A座移到C座,中間可以借用B座但每次只能允許移動一個盤子,並且在移動過程中, 個座上的盤子始終保持大盤在下, ...
2015-10-22 20:53 5 1391 推薦指數:
有三根針A、B、C。A針上有N個盤子,大的在下,小的在上,要求把這N個盤子從A針移到C針,在移動過程中可以借助B針,每次只允許移動一個盤, ...
③最后將B上的1個圓盤移到C上。 ★★★有了代碼就好辦了★★★ 代碼奉上▼ 關於C++與Dev-C++的下載 ...
今天為大家講一道非常有趣的問題,hanoi塔問題,相信很多同學都曾經玩過這個游戲,今天我們嘗試着靠編程來解決它 題目描述 A、B、C 是3個塔座。開始時,在塔座A 上有一疊共n 個圓盤,這些圓盤自下而上,由大到小地疊在一起。各圓盤從小到大編號為1,2,……,n ...
目的:領會基本遞歸算法設計和遞歸到非遞歸的轉換方法 內容:編寫一個程序exp5-1.cpp,采用遞歸和非遞歸方法求解Hanoi問題,輸出三個盤片的移動過程 寫在前面 題目是昨天老師發在學習通上的,目前 解決了: Hanoi問題理解 Hanoi遞歸算法及其實現 ...
十分慚愧,水平有限,更新博文速度太慢。太慢的原因應該歸結於人太懶惰,水平也有限;或是本人太自以為是,自認為有意思的東西才會發表博文,像今天早上喝了豆漿吃了包子這種炫富的事情我是不會更新到博客的 ...
背景 對策論研究具有競爭性質的現象。有權決定自身行為的對策參加者稱為局中人,所有局中人構成集合 \(I\),在一局對策中可供劇中人選擇的一個實際可行的完整的行動方案成為策略,對於任意劇中人 \(i ...
指派問題概述: 實際中,會遇到這樣的問題,有n項不同的任務,需要n個人分別完成其中的1項,每個人完成任務的時間不一樣。於是就有一個問題,如何分配任務使得花費時間最少。 通俗來講,就是n*n矩陣中,選取n個元素,每行每列各有1個元素,使得和最小。 如下圖: 指派問題 ...
目錄 最小二乘問題 初等正交變換 Householder 變換 Givens 變換 正交變換法 最小二乘問題 定義 3.1.1 給定矩陣 \(A\in\mathbb{R}^{m\times n}\) 及向量 \(b ...